Senior Adult Program Card: OneCard
Attention: Anyone who is 55 years of age or better must purchase a College of the Mainland Senior OneCard. To obtain this card, please go to the Welcome Center located in the Enrollment Center to have your picture taken. The cost is $10 for seniors in-district residents of Texas City, La Marque, Dickinson, San Leon, Bacliff, Hitchcock, Santa Fe, Algoa, Arcadia and Alta Loma and $20 for all other seniors who are considered out-of-district residents.
This card is non-refundable and is valid for one academic year, Sept. 1, 2010 to Aug. 31, 2011.
Note: If you purchase the card later in a fiscal year, there is no proportional discount on the $10/$20 card. There is also a special discount for members of The JSC Federal Credit Union who have a checking or savings account.
The Senior OneCard entitles you to:
- Enroll in Senior Adult Program classes at nominal cost.
- Enroll in Senior Adult trips at nominal cost.
- A 50 percent tuition-only reduction for Continuing Education classes (Note: All fees, book fees and facility charges are not discounted and must be paid upon enrollment. See Continuing Education Schedule).
- Big discount on senior recreational membership.
- Use of the COM Library.
- Use of the Innovations Computer lab in TVB 320.
- Discount on COM Cosmetology Services. Call 409.933.8480 for more information.
- Big discount on tickets for college plays and theater productions. Call 409.933.8345 for more information.
- View theater performances for $5 on special Senior Days.
- Blood pressure reading with automated monitor available daily in Senior Adult Program Office.
Who is a senior adult?
Any person 55 years of age or better.
How do I purchase a OneCard?
If you are purchasing a OneCard for the first time, you must show proof of age by presenting any of the following: a driver’s license, birth certificate, state ID card, passport. The picture card ID can be obtained at the Welcome Center located in the Enrollment Center. The Senior OneCard is non-refundable.
